Overview of the Website: The Genesis of an AI Giant

OpenAI (openai.com) was founded in December 2015 by a group of prominent figures, including Elon Musk, Sam Altman, Greg Brockman, Ilya Sutskever, Wojciech Zaremba, and John Schulman. Initially established as a non-profit organization, its core objective was to advance digital intelligence in a way that benefits humanity as a whole, rather than being solely driven by profit. This ambitious mission aimed to prevent the potentially catastrophic outcomes of powerful AI by fostering an open and collaborative research environment.

The company's journey began with a focus on foundational AI research, exploring areas like reinforcement learning and natural language processing. History of OpenAI and Its Evolutionary Stages: A Journey from Concept to Colossus

The trajectory of OpenAI is a compelling narrative of continuous innovation and strategic adaptation. Its inception in 2015 was fueled by the urgent need to address the long-term safety and societal implications of advanced artificial intelligence. The founders recognized that unchecked AI development could pose significant risks, hence their commitment to a non-profit model focused on public benefit.

  • Foundational Years (2015-2018): The initial phase saw OpenAI concentrating on fundamental research. Key early projects included Gym, a toolkit for developing and comparing reinforcement learning algorithms, and advancements in robotics. This period was characterized by a strong emphasis on open-source contributions and collaboration within the AI community.

  • Transition to "Capped-Profit" (2019): A pivotal moment arrived in 2019 when OpenAI transitioned to a "capped-profit" model. This change was necessitated by the immense computational resources and talent required for developing large-scale AI models. While still prioritizing its mission, this structure allowed OpenAI to raise substantial capital, notably from Microsoft, while ensuring that financial returns would be capped and redirected towards its mission. This marked the beginning of significant funding rounds to fuel its ambitious research and development.

  • The Era of Large Language Models (2020-Present): This period witnessed the groundbreaking release of models like GPT-3 and the subsequent ChatGPT. These models revolutionized text generation, summarization, and conversation, bringing advanced AI capabilities to a much wider audience. OpenAI also expanded into image generation with DALL-E, showcasing its versatility. These transformative updates propelled OpenAI into the global spotlight, making its technologies accessible through user-friendly interfaces and robust APIs. The company has continually refined its models, pushing the boundaries of what AI can achieve.

Services Offered:

  • ChatGPT: A highly sophisticated conversational AI model capable of engaging in natural dialogue, answering questions, writing various text formats, and assisting with tasks across numerous domains. It's renowned for its versatility and ability to understand context.

  • DALL-E: An AI system that generates original images from text descriptions. This service has democratized digital art creation, allowing users to visualize complex concepts with simple prompts.

  • GPT API: A powerful Application Programming Interface that allows developers to integrate OpenAI's advanced language models into their own applications, products, and services. This enables custom AI solutions tailored to specific needs.

  • Whisper: An open-source AI model designed for robust speech-to-text transcription, capable of handling multiple languages and varying audio qualities.

  • Embedding Models: These models convert text into numerical representations, enabling advanced natural language processing tasks like semantic search, text classification, and clustering.

Economic Model and Revenue Streams: Funding the Future of AI

OpenAI employs a hybrid business model that combines its research-focused non-profit roots with a "capped-profit" structure designed to attract significant investment for its capital-intensive AI development. This unique model allows it to pursue ambitious AGI goals while generating revenue.

  • Paid Subscriptions (Premium/Subscription): OpenAI offers premium versions of its services, notably ChatGPT Plus, providing users with enhanced features like faster response times, priority access to new functionalities, and access during peak hours. ChatGPT Enterprise and ChatGPT Team offer advanced security, admin controls, and integration capabilities for businesses. These subscriptions provide a stable and growing revenue stream. ChatGPT Plus has around 10 million paying subscribers.

  • API Licensing: A significant portion of OpenAI's revenue comes from licensing its powerful AI models (like GPT-4 and DALL-E) to businesses and developers through its API platform. Companies integrate these models into their own products, tools, and operations for various applications, from chatbots to content generation.

  • Strategic Partnerships: The deep collaboration with Microsoft involves substantial investments (totaling over $14 billion in various rounds) and contributes to OpenAI's financial stability, providing access to vast cloud computing resources and market reach.

  • Future Revenue Streams: While currently less prominent, OpenAI may explore other avenues such as specialized consulting services for AI implementation, custom model fine-tuning for enterprise clients, and potentially new consumer-facing products as its capabilities expand.

OpenAI has seen rapid revenue growth, with projected annual sales of $12.7 billion in 2025. This financial strength is vital for sustaining its expensive research and development efforts.

Challenges and Competition:

  • Intense Competition: The AI landscape is highly competitive, with major players like Google (with Gemini), Anthropic (with Claude), and Meta (with Llama) constantly developing rival models. OpenAI maintains its edge through continuous innovation, strategic partnerships, and rapid deployment of cutting-edge research.

  • Technical Challenges: Scaling its infrastructure to meet exponentially growing demand, ensuring the security of its models against adversarial attacks, and continually improving model performance and efficiency remain significant technical hurdles.

  • Regulatory/Legal Challenges: OpenAI faces a growing number of legal challenges, particularly concerning copyright infringement due to the use of publicly available data for training. It is also subject to increasing scrutiny from global regulators on issues like data privacy, algorithmic bias, and antitrust concerns. These legal battles could shape the future of AI development.
